The Role of Exemestane in Athletics
Exemestane is an aromatase inhibitor that has been gaining attention in the world of athletics. Originally designed for the treatment of breast cancer in postmenopausal women, it functions by blocking the conversion of androgens to estrogens, lowering estrogen levels in the body. Athletes have started exploring its potential benefits in performance enhancement, particularly in sports that emphasize strength and muscle mass.

How Exemestane Works
Exemestane’s primary function is the suppression of estrogen production. This can lead to various physiological changes that can be advantageous for athletes:
- Increased Testosterone Levels: With reduced estrogen levels, the body may increase testosterone production, which is crucial for muscle growth and recovery.
- Fat Loss: Lower estrogen levels can promote fat oxidation, helping athletes achieve a leaner physique.
- Improved Recovery: By supporting higher testosterone levels, Exemestane may enhance recovery times after intense workouts and competitions.
Risks and Considerations
While Exemestane might offer certain benefits, athletes should also be aware of the potential risks involved:
- Hormonal Imbalance: Improper use can lead to undesirable side effects such as mood swings, fatigue, and decreased bone density.
- Legal and Ethical Issues: Exemestane is banned by many sports organizations, making its use risky for athletes concerned about doping violations.
- Health Problems: Long-term suppression of estrogen can lead to other health issues, including cardiovascular problems and changes in lipid profiles.
